[php-pear-Image-GraphViz] - clean spec
Remi Collet
remi at fedoraproject.org
Sun Aug 15 12:47:44 UTC 2010
commit a926274dd1f863f50891b9c51d359c03fa1ee3a6
Author: remi <fedora at famillecollet.com>
Date: Sun Aug 15 14:47:30 2010 +0200
- clean spec
PHP-LICENSE-3.01 | 68 ------------------------------------------
php-pear-Image-GraphViz.spec | 21 +++++++------
2 files changed, 11 insertions(+), 78 deletions(-)
---
diff --git a/php-pear-Image-GraphViz.spec b/php-pear-Image-GraphViz.spec
index 07abc3e..a60544e 100644
--- a/php-pear-Image-GraphViz.spec
+++ b/php-pear-Image-GraphViz.spec
@@ -1,16 +1,16 @@
%{!?__pear: %{expand: %%global __pear %{_bindir}/pear}}
-%define ClassName Image_GraphViz
+%global ClassName Image_GraphViz
Name: php-pear-Image-GraphViz
Version: 1.2.1
-Release: 6%{?dist}
+Release: 7%{?dist}
Summary: Interface to AT&T's GraphViz tools
Group: Development/Libraries
License: PHP
URL: http://pear.php.net/package/Image_GraphViz
Source0: http://pear.php.net/get/%{ClassName}-%{version}.tgz
-Source1: PHP-LICENSE-3.01
+
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
BuildArch: noarch
@@ -28,9 +28,8 @@ undirected graphs and their visualization with AT&T's GraphViz tools.
%prep
%setup -qc
[ -f package2.xml ] || mv package.xml package2.xml
-mv package2.xml %{ClassName}-%{version}/%{ClassName}.xml
+mv package2.xml %{ClassName}-%{version}/%{name}.xml
cd %{ClassName}-%{version}
-install -pm 644 %{SOURCE1} LICENSE
%build
@@ -41,14 +40,14 @@ cd %{ClassName}-%{version}
%install
cd %{ClassName}-%{version}
rm -rf $RPM_BUILD_ROOT docdir
-%{__pear} install --nodeps --packagingroot $RPM_BUILD_ROOT %{ClassName}.xml
+%{__pear} install --nodeps --packagingroot $RPM_BUILD_ROOT %{name}.xml
# Clean up unnecessary files
rm -rf $RPM_BUILD_ROOT%{pear_phpdir}/.??*
# Install XML package description
install -d $RPM_BUILD_ROOT%{pear_xmldir}
-install -pm 644 %{ClassName}.xml $RPM_BUILD_ROOT%{pear_xmldir}
+install -pm 644 %{name}.xml $RPM_BUILD_ROOT%{pear_xmldir}
%clean
@@ -57,7 +56,7 @@ rm -rf $RPM_BUILD_ROOT
%post
%{__pear} install --nodeps --soft --force --register-only \
- %{pear_xmldir}/%{ClassName}.xml >/dev/null ||:
+ %{pear_xmldir}/%{name}.xml >/dev/null ||:
%postun
if [ "$1" -eq "0" ]; then
@@ -68,13 +67,15 @@ fi
%files
%defattr(-,root,root,-)
-%doc %{ClassName}-%{version}/LICENSE
-%{pear_xmldir}/%{ClassName}.xml
+%{pear_xmldir}/%{name}.xml
%{pear_phpdir}/Image
%{pear_phpdir}/Image/GraphViz.php
%changelog
+* Sun Aug 15 2010 Remi Collet <Fedora at FamilleCollet.com> - 1.2.1-7
+- clean spec
+
* Sun Jul 26 2009 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 1.2.1-6
- Rebuilt for https://fedoraproject.org/wiki/Fedora_12_Mass_Rebuild
More information about the scm-commits
mailing list